How to fill out 150th celebratory committee

01
Start by creating a planning committee for the 150th celebratory event.
02
Determine the goals and objectives of the committee.
03
Decide on a budget and allocate funds for the event.
04
Identify key tasks and assign responsibilities to committee members.
05
Plan the event program, including activities, entertainment, and speeches.
06
Coordinate with vendors and suppliers for necessary arrangements.
07
Promote the event through various marketing channels.
08
Collect feedback and make necessary adjustments as the event date approaches.
09
Execute the planned event on the designated date.
10
Evaluate the success of the event and document lessons learned for future reference.
